Staffing
CMS staffing rating: 1 of 5 stars. CMS calculates that rating separately using its published methodology. The values below are calculations from daily PBJ records for 2026Q1 (current source quarter).
| Measure | Monday–Friday | Saturday–Sunday |
|---|---|---|
| Total nursing | 3.405 | 3.048 |
| RN categories | 0.514 | 0.19 |
Contract staff accounted for 8% of reported nursing hours included in this quarter calculation.
PBJ reports zero combined RN-category hours on 10 days with a positive MDS census in this quarter.
Reported RN-category hours per resident day were 0.044 lower than the prior loaded quarter.
Solid bar: Total nursing · Outlined bar: RN categories
| Quarter | Total nursing | RN categories | LPN/LVN | CNA | Contract share | Days |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025Q2 | 3.247 | 0.709 | 0.584 | 1.954 | 5.9% | 91 |
| 2025Q3 | 3.457 | 0.654 | 0.675 | 2.129 | 6.3% | 92 |
| 2025Q4 | 3.71 | 0.464 | 0.873 | 2.373 | 6% | 92 |
| 2026Q1 | 3.301 | 0.42 | 0.819 | 2.063 | 8% | 90 |
Hours-per-resident-day values are calculated by this platform from CMS-published daily PBJ hours and MDS census. For each displayed period, included hours are summed and divided by the summed census for days with a positive census. They are not CMS case-mix-adjusted staffing measures or a staffing rating.
